3. Seth Rollins (Intercontinental Champion)

If there is one superstar who has matched the excitement and entertainment that Becky’s heel turn has brought this company, it is Seth freakin’ Rollins. Monday Night Rollins has been in full effect for months now, and Seth’s reign as Intercontinental Champion has yielded PLENTY of fantastic matches. Although he and his Shield brethren Ambrose came up short at Hell in a Cell for the Raw Tag titles, The Architect’s stock has done nothing but rise since becoming IC champ.

On Monday night, Rollins was forced to defend his title against Dolph Ziggler, after both men took a hellacious fall off the cell through the announce table the night before at Hell in a Cell. Although it was clear both men were severely banged up, they put on one heck of a show. After hitting Ziggler with just about everything Seth had, it seemed Dolph may have been poised to steal his title back from the champ, when he rolled him up and grabbed a fistful of tights. However, Seth kicked out at 2, popped up, and hit a devastating Stomp to Dolph to retain his IC title.

He and The Shield are scheduled for a huge six-man tag match at Super Show-Down against Strowman, McIntyre, and Ziggler. With his reign as Intercontinental champ in full swing, Rollins putting on excellent match after excellent match, and being, arguably, the most over superstar in the company, Seth Rollins is sure to be a staple of our Rankings from here on out.
